How to measure the throat space on your machine
Before you spend money on more room, find out how much you already have. Almost nobody knows their own machine's height figure, and it is the one that decides everything.

Two measurements. Width: from the right-hand side of the needle to the body of the machine, along the bed. Height: from the bed surface straight up to the lowest point of the arm above it. Take both with the presser foot up and the needle at its highest position, and write both down - the second one is the one that matters.
Why measure it yourself at all
Because for a large share of machines, nobody published the number. Across the machines on the throat space chart, several makers publish a single width with no height beside it - bernette gives 9 in for the 79 and no height, Brother gives 7.4 in from needle to arm for the SE2000 and no height. If your machine is older or was sold under a store brand, there may be no specification page left at all.
And because the decision you are trying to make is a comparison. “Is it worth upgrading?” is unanswerable until you know what you are upgrading from.

Measuring the width
Set the needle at its highest position and raise the presser foot. Lay the tape flat on the bed of the machine, starting at the right-hand edge of the needle, and run it horizontally to where the vertical body of the machine rises out of the bed.
Read the number where the tape meets the body. That is your width - what the industry calls the throat, the harp or the needle-to-arm space, all of which mean the same thing and are covered on harp space vs throat space.
Measure from the needle, not from the edge of the needle plate. The needle is the fixed reference every manufacturer uses, and starting from the plate edge will flatter your machine by an inch or more.
Measuring the height, which is the one people skip
Stand a ruler on the bed of the machine, just to the right of the needle, and read off the point where it meets the underside of the arm.
Two things to watch. First, the arm is not flat - it usually curves down toward the needle end, so take the reading at the lowest point of the arm, not the roomiest. Second, if your machine has a removable free arm cover or an extension table, measure with the setup you actually quilt in.
This is the number almost nobody has and the number that decides whether a quilt fits. A rolled quilt is a cylinder, and a cylinder that will not clear the height does not care how much width is waiting for it.
Turn the two numbers into one
Width times height is the number to compare
Multiply your two measurements together. That is your opening in square inches, and it is directly comparable with every machine on this site.
A very common domestic machine measures roughly 6.5 x 4.0 in = 26 sq in. The Juki TL-2010Q publishes 8.5 x 6.0 in = 51 sq in. That is not 30% more room, which is what the width figures suggest - it is 96% more.
Comparing widths alone is what makes upgrades look marginal when they are not, and what makes wide-but-short machines look better than they are.
Why your number will not match the published one
Expect to be within about a quarter inch, and do not worry if you are not exactly on it. Three reasons the figures drift:
The reference point. Makers measure from the needle center or from the needle’s right-hand edge, and they do not usually say which. That is a few millimeters on its own.
The height reference. Some figures are taken from the needle plate and some from the bed surface, which sit at slightly different levels.
The convention. This is the big one. Brother publishes the PQ1600S as “5.7″ x 8.7″ needle-to-arm space” - height first - while publishing its embroidery work areas width first, with nothing on the page saying which is which. If you are checking your measurement against a spec sheet, work out which number is which before deciding you measured wrong. Every figure on this site is normalized to width by height with the maker’s original wording recorded beside it.
Where your machine sits
Once you have your figure, this is the company it is in. Every row is a published manufacturer figure, normalized to width by height:
| Machine | Published work space | Opening |
|---|---|---|
| Juki TL-2010Q / TL-2000Qi | 8.5 x 6.0 in | 51.0 sq in |
| Brother PQ1600S | 8.7 x 5.7 in | 49.6 sq in |
| Brother PQ1500SL | 8.6 x 5.7 in | 49.0 sq in |
| Janome MC6700P | 10.04 x 4.72 in | 47.4 sq in |
| Brother NQ3550W | 8.3 x 4.1 in | 34.0 sq in |
| Brother SE600 | 6.4 x 4.1 in | 26.2 sq in |
| Brother SE700 | 6.4 x 4.0 in | 25.6 sq in |
If your own measurement lands near the bottom of that table, an upgrade is a real change rather than a marginal one. If it lands near the top, more room is not your problem and you should spend the money elsewhere.
The other measurement worth taking
Roll up the largest quilt top you own, as tightly as you would to get it under the machine, and measure the diameter of the roll.
Now compare that with your height figure. If the roll is thicker than the opening is tall, the quilt is not going through, and no amount of extra width will change that. That single comparison answers the upgrade question faster than any specification sheet, and the sizing rules of thumb are on how much throat space you need.

Do not buy on the width figure alone
Width is what gets advertised because it is the bigger, better-sounding number. The Janome MC6700P publishes 10.04 in of width and has a smaller opening than the Juki TL-2010Q at 8.5 in, because the Juki has 6.0 in of height against 4.72.
If you take one thing from this page, take the habit of asking for the second number. The full argument is on width vs height.

Juki
Juki TL-2010Q
Semi-professional straight-stitch tier
8.5 in wide by 6 in high of arm space, straight stitch only, at 1,500 stitches per minute. Six inches of usable height is the number to notice: it is the most vertical room of any domestic machine in this comparison, and height is what a rolled quilt actually consumes.
Skip it if: You need decorative stitches or a buttonhole. This machine does one stitch, in one direction, extremely well, and nothing else at all.

Brother
Brother PQ1600S
Semi-professional straight-stitch tier
The widest domestic throat here at 8.7 in, with a published 11.1 x 23.3 in extension table and 1,500 spm. It trades 0.3 in of height for 0.2 in of width against the Juki, and adds a pin feed system the Juki has no equivalent for.
Skip it if: You want one machine to do everything. Like the Jukis, this is straight stitch only.

Janome
Janome Memory Craft 6700 Professional
Upper domestic tier
10 inches to the right of the needle and 200 built-in stitches: the widest machine here that still does everything a domestic machine does. The catch is 120 mm of height, the lowest opening in this comparison.
Skip it if: Your bottleneck is a king-size quilt rolled under the arm. Extra width does not help if the roll will not clear 4.7 in of height.

How do you measure throat space on a sewing machine?
Measure horizontally from the right-hand edge of the needle to the body of the machine for the width, then vertically from the bed up to the lowest point of the arm for the height. Take both with the needle up and the presser foot raised, and multiply them together to get the opening in square inches.
Where exactly do you start the tape measure?
At the needle, not at the edge of the needle plate. The needle is the reference point every manufacturer uses. Starting from the plate edge can add an inch or more and makes your machine look roomier than it is.
Why does my measurement not match the manufacturer's figure?
Usually the reference point or the order of the numbers. Makers measure from the needle center or its right edge without saying which, and some publish the figure height first - Brother does on its PQ pages - so a width and a height can look swapped. Within about a quarter inch is normal.
Is throat space the same as harp space?
Yes. Throat space, harp space, needle-to-arm space and work space all describe the same opening. The terms are used interchangeably by different makers, which is one reason the numbers are so hard to compare.
What is a good throat space for quilting?
For a throw, roughly 4 in of height is workable. For a queen, around 6 in is what makes it comfortable - which is what the Juki TL machines publish. Width helps support the quilt but height is what decides whether the roll goes through at all.
Does an extension table increase throat space?
No. A table extends the flat surface around the machine, which supports the weight of the quilt and stops it dragging the stitch line crooked. It does not change the size of the opening the quilt has to pass through, which is set by the machine casting.
